• Show log

    Commit

  • Hash : 0690f5d3
    Author : Ian Elliott
    Date : 2022-04-21T21:58:49

    Revert "CGL, MTL: pbuffer for IOSurface fails for some formats"
    
    This reverts commit 5b84ad7973a3019b66848aabb2d2eef27c094545.
    
    Reason for revert: Breaks the build on the bots (see below)
    
    Example AutoRoll CL that has compilation pre-submit error: https://chromium-review.googlesource.com/c/chromium/src/+/3598558
    
    Example bot results, showing compilation error: https://ci.chromium.org/ui/p/chromium/builders/try/ios-simulator/1143059/overview
    
    Original change's description:
    > CGL, MTL: pbuffer for IOSurface fails for some formats
    >
    > Some IOSurface SPI formats are compressed, and getting the
    > element size for those returns values that are not consistent
    > with the validation. Disable the validation
    > until a better detection of such formats are known.
    >
    > A workaround exists for EAGL.
    > Apply similar workaround for CGL and Metal.
    >
    > This hunk is in downtstream WebKit ANGLE and having it upstream would
    > help merging back and forth.
    >
    > Bug: angleproject:7175
    > Change-Id: Ic97afd3b952fed236e7b7e1e8511a1dde9008647
    > Reviewed-on: https://chromium-review.googlesource.com/c/angle/angle/+/3568380
    > Reviewed-by: Geoff Lang <geofflang@chromium.org>
    > Reviewed-by: Kenneth Russell <kbr@chromium.org>
    > Commit-Queue: Kenneth Russell <kbr@chromium.org>
    
    Bug: angleproject:7175
    Change-Id: I0c18bdb800e39d6930455dbc86931681b6df20b1
    Reviewed-on: https://chromium-review.googlesource.com/c/angle/angle/+/3600148
    Bot-Commit: Rubber Stamper <rubber-stamper@appspot.gserviceaccount.com>
    Reviewed-by: Ian Elliott <ianelliott@google.com>
    Commit-Queue: Ian Elliott <ianelliott@google.com>
    Auto-Submit: Ian Elliott <ianelliott@google.com>
    

  • Properties

  • Git HTTP https://git.kmx.io/kc3-lang/angle.git
    Git SSH git@git.kmx.io:kc3-lang/angle.git
    Public access ? public
    Description

    A conformant OpenGL ES implementation for Windows, Mac, Linux, iOS and Android.

    Homepage

    Github

    Users
    thodg_m kc3_lang_org thodg_w www_kmx_io thodg_l thodg
    Tags